The Real Cost of Autistic Burnout in Schools
Autistic burnout is a silent crisis in schools, where students face mounting sensory and social demands that can lead to exhaustion, anxiety, and mental health struggles. Occupational therapists on the front lines bear the weight of managing these cases with limited resources and time.
Manually writing detailed school-home pacing guides is a tedious, time-consuming task that distracts from direct patient care. Overwhelmed OTs often resort to generic daily schedules or hastily copied notes between appointments, missing key milestones and progress markers.
This inconsistent documentation leads to miscommunication between home and school, causing frustration for families and educators trying to support the student. The financial cost of this inefficiency manifests in longer therapy cycles, delayed functional gains, and increased staffing demands to cover gaps in caseloads. For students with severe autistic burnout, these missed opportunities can mean the difference between regaining independence or falling further behind academically and socially.
The human cost is even higher. Children experiencing autistic burnout often withdraw from activities they once loved, leading to isolation and lowered self-esteem.
As their condition worsens, they may develop co-occurring mental health disorders like depression or anxiety. For parents and caregivers, the added stress of a struggling student can strain family dynamics and relationships. The pressure falls on educators as well, who must adapt lesson plans and social interactions for increasingly exhausted students, requiring additional training and emotional resilience to prevent classroom burnout among their own staff.
Free AI Prompt: Autistic Burnout Pacing Guide
This prompt allows occupational therapists to instantly generate a highly customized pacing guide for autistic students experiencing burnout in school settings. It ensures that critical questions regarding sensory sensitivities, social demands, and functional milestones are systematically addressed during the therapy planning process.
You are an occupational therapist specializing in pediatric cases involving autistic students. Generate a highly detailed, professional school-home pacing guide for a student named [Student Name], who is experiencing symptoms of autistic burnout. The guide must include specific activities tailored to their unique sensory preferences and social needs. Break down the plan into daily, weekly, and monthly tasks. Incorporate recommended sensory strategies like deep pressure, brushing, or preferred seating arrangements. Use the COAST goal-writing framework to establish clear objectives for each therapy session.
Structure the pacing guide with a consistent format that can be easily shared between schools and home caregivers.
Do not use real PII.
